Calculate Log Base 343 of 186

To solve the equation log 343 (186) = x carry out the following steps.
  1. Apply the change of base rule:
    log a (x) = log b (x) / log b (a)
    With b = 10:
    log a (x) = log(x) / log(a)
  2. Substitute the variables:
    With x = 186, a = 343:
    log 343 (186) = log(186) / log(343)
  3. Evaluate the term:
    log(186) / log(343)
    = 1.39794000867204 / 1.92427928606188
    = 0.89516751775515
